The King's Academy is a secondary school in Middlesbrough, serving pupils aged 11 to 18. The school is a academy sponsor led and operates as a mixed school. It follows a non-selective admissions policy. It has a christian religious character. The school also offers a sixth form, allowing students to continue into post-16 education on site.

The King's Academy currently has around 1416 pupils on roll, which is about 93% of its capacity. The gender split is relatively balanced, with approximately 48.9% boys and 51.1% girls. Around 38.2%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, which gives an indication of the socio-economic mix. Pupil backgrounds are varied across different backgrounds and needs.

Overall absence at the school is 12.9%. Persistent absence is recorded at 36.1%. The school also includes resourced provision, supporting 78 pupils.

The majority of pupils are from a white british background (82.7%).

At its latest Ofsted inspection, the school was rated Good. This suggests the school is performing well overall. Safeguarding was judged to be effective, which is a key consideration for many parents.

Around 94% of pupils move on to sustained destinations after Year 11. Most continue into education (84%) , including 40% who stay in school sixth forms and 37% progressing to further education , while 4% enter apprenticeships .
